Output 1f5d9119b3b623b5650af38e9ed146051739a93caf438ba2c80dd06d0c646d1f:17

value
28518582
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eb25fd33c1a5e083baea4f534b08f3b76d659cdc OP_EQUAL
address
MVLWY37c8SVaMKVH4mWeUbxxyexaqztG9E
transaction
1f5d9119b3b623b5650af38e9ed146051739a93caf438ba2c80dd06d0c646d1f
spent
true